In a chord containing a second, if I place the fingering above the
notes to avoid having the fingering numerals overlapping each other
(see
https://code.google.com/p/lilypond/issues/detail?id=2541),
then the numerals default to being placed much higher above the
noteheads than is normal or if either of the notes in the second is
omitted from the chord: \version "2.15.43" \relative c'' { \set fingeringOrientations = #'(left) \override Fingering #'staff-padding = #'() \override Fingering #'add-stem-support = ##f <d-0 c-3 f,-0>4 <d^0 c^3 f,-0> <d^0 f,-0> <c^3 f,-0> } |
